Generally speaking, cats become sexually mature around 8 months old. When a cat is in heat for the first time, its reproductive organs are not fully developed. However, after 2-3 months of sexual maturity, no matter if it is a male cat, it will become sexually mature. The testicles of the cat and the ovaries of the female cat are basically mature and can ovulate and sperm normally. However, this stage is not the best breeding stage because the cat at this time is not yet physically mature, and its bones and muscles have not yet developed. Sound, if blindly bred, problems such as degeneration, malformation, polygenetic diseases, thinness, and short lifespan of the offspring are likely to occur. Therefore, it is best to wait until the cat is mature before breeding. Generally, female cats are born after 1 year old. Male cats are born after 1 and a half years old.
